Abstract :
The video on demand (VOD) service is one of major service drivers for IN CS-3, being currently examined by the ITU-T SG11. This paper presents the IN.CS-3 functional model and physical scenarios for Digital Audio Visual Council (DAVIC) compliant VOD service taking into account the evolutional approach from the IN CS-2. The purpose of the DAVIC is to specify emerging digital audio-visual applications and services such as broadcast or interactive services, by the timely availability of internationally agreed specifications of open interfaces and protocols that maximize interoperability cross countries and application/services.
